Anxiety
Each person reacts uniquely to using THCa, especially when they convert it to THC cannabis with heat. The decarboxylation process, which occurs from the heat reaction, causes intoxication in the user.
Intoxication itself can be a fun or bad trip. For some people, getting high triggers anxiety and its symptoms, such as panic attacks, hyperventilation, tachycardia (heavy heartbeat), and paranoia.

Dose Control
Another leading cause for negative or prolonged THCa side effects is a lack of quantity control. You can’t afford to use THCa indiscriminately and then get confused when the side effects are extreme or last longer than expected.
Like with any other drug, use your THCa in moderation. As a beginner, start really slowly and observe your body’s response. Then, as you build tolerance, you can increase your dosage.
